首页 / 服务器资讯 / 正文
优化策略与实践,怎么提高后端服务器性能,怎么提高后端服务器性能的方法

Time:2025年02月12日 Read:8 评论:42 作者:y21dr45

随着互联网技术的飞速发展,用户对于网站和应用的响应速度要求越来越高,后端服务器作为处理业务逻辑、数据存储和交互的核心组件,其性能直接影响到用户体验和服务质量,本文将从多个维度探讨如何有效提升后端服务器的性能,确保应用能够高效、稳定地运行。

优化策略与实践,怎么提高后端服务器性能,怎么提高后端服务器性能的方法

硬件层面优化

- 升级CPU与内存:选择高性能的处理器和足够的内存是基础,多核CPU能有效处理并发请求,而充足的内存则能减少磁盘I/O操作,提升数据处理速度。

- 使用SSD存储:相较于传统机械硬盘,固态硬盘(SSD)具有更快的读写速度,可以显著减少数据库访问延迟,加快数据检索和写入速度。

- 负载均衡:通过硬件或软件实现负载均衡,将请求均匀分配到多台服务器上,避免单点过载,提高系统的可用性和扩展性。

软件与架构优化

- 优化代码与算法:审查现有代码,优化算法复杂度,减少不必要的计算和资源消耗,采用异步编程模型,如Node.js的非阻塞I/O,可以大幅提升并发处理能力。

- 数据库优化:选择合适的数据库类型(关系型或非关系型),合理设计索引,定期进行性能分析并调整查询,实施分库分表策略,应对大规模数据存储需求。

- 缓存机制:利用Redis、Memcached等缓存技术,将频繁访问的数据暂存于内存中,减轻数据库压力,加速数据访问速度。

网络优化

- CDN加速:内容分发网络(CDN)可以将静态资源分布到全球多个节点,使用户从最近的节点获取数据,大大缩短数据传输时间。

- HTTP/2与WebSocket:采用HTTP/2协议,支持多路复用,减少连接建立的开销;对于实时通信需求,使用WebSocket替代传统的轮询方式,提高通信效率。

安全与监控

- 安全防护:实施防火墙、DDoS防护等措施,保护服务器免受恶意攻击,确保服务稳定性。

- 性能监控与日志分析:部署性能监控工具(如New Relic、Prometheus),实时监测服务器状态,及时发现并解决性能瓶颈,分析日志文件,了解用户行为模式,为进一步优化提供依据。

容器化与微服务架构

- 容器化技术(如Docker):通过容器封装应用及其依赖,实现快速部署与隔离,便于环境一致性管理,同时易于扩展和迁移。

- 微服务架构:将大型单体应用拆分成若干小型、独立的服务,每个服务专注于特定功能,独立部署和扩展,提高了系统的灵活性和可维护性。

提高后端服务器性能是一个涉及硬件、软件、网络及运维等多方面的综合工程,通过持续优化上述各个环节,结合具体业务场景和需求,可以有效提升后端服务器的处理能力和响应速度,为用户提供更加流畅、高效的服务体验,在实践过程中,还应注重团队协作与知识共享,不断探索新技术和方法,以适应不断变化的业务和技术挑战。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1